About Fergal
Meet Fergal, a two year old Jack Russell Terrier with a quirky personality and quite a wild history! His backstory involves a near-death experience from falling off a cliff and also an emergency abdominal surgery...
This little guy has been through a thing or two and as a result, he has developed some anxious behaviours which unfortunately has impacted his ability to stay with his family and their newborn child but he is an absolute legend of a dog and we know there's a wonderful person out there waiting to embrace him and help him become his best self. Could it be you?
Fergal is an active dude and needs at least one walk a day. He is lead trained and will sit for treats but he would benefit from ongoing training as he has not yet developed his recall and can be a cheeky little fellow if left off lead. Fergal loves car rides - he would make the perfect companion for an adventurous person with lots of time to spend exploring the world with him.
He does love to admire a good view but be sure to keep clear of cliffs! When Fergal was one year old he was out on a coastal walk with a larger dog when he was accidentally bumped off the edge of a cliff! He fell over 20 metres and suffered a severed concussion which saw him drift in and out of consciousness for almost a week, requiring close veterinary attention and rehabilitation. Thankfully he had no physical injuries and he has made a full recovery but that incident, coupled with an emergency surgery some months later to remove a grass seed from his bladder, has left Fergal feeling quite vulnerable at times and in need of patience and reassurance.
Some of the behavioural changes his family noticed were that Fergal now becomes nervous around large dogs that he doesn't know and he is frightened of loud noises and thunder storms. His anxiety sometimes takes shape in protective behaviours such as barking at people who approach the house and car or chasing small animals that come near his yard. He also doesn't enjoy being around small children as he feels threatened when they encroach on his personal space. For this reason we have excluded applicants with young children or small animals.
Despite all this, Fergal is still a happy chappy and can be a lot of fun! He has a very cuddly side to him too - he loves napping on laps, which makes him the ideal snuggle buddy! He enjoys playing with toys and would benefit from environmental enrichment such as chew toys to keep him entertained, especially if left indoors alone. He would love someone to teach him to play fetch and visit lots of new places for him to sniff!
Fergal would be well suited to someone looking for a full time companion to go on walks and cuddle up on the couch with. Someone who has the time and patience to attend dog training to improve on Fergal's manners and help him grow more confident in social situations. You will be rewarded with a lot of snuggles- and a lot of laughter too as he is very entertaining character. He just needs the right home to flourish!
